正交胶合木结构在地震作用下的层间位移角研究

【摘要】 根据正交胶合木(cross-laminated timber,简称CLT)结构的节点和墙体试验数据校核了有限元模拟的滞回曲线,建立了CLT结构节点和墙体有限元模型。采用规范推荐的基于承栽力的设计方法分别设计了一幢三层和一幢六层CLT结构,并采用简化方法建立了该结构整体有限元模型。选取41条双向水平地震波,根据罕遇地震、设防地震、多遇地震的设计反应谱将所选地震波调幅至分别代表大震、中震、小震的三组地震波,对结构进行增量动力分析(IDA)。最后根据层间位移角的IDA曲线并结合可靠度要求,计算出罕遇地震、设防地震、多遇地震下多层CLT剪力墙结构的位移角限值。

【Abstract】 The hysteresis curves of the finite element method(FEM) simulation results are calibrated with the test results of the cross-laminated timber(CLT) connections and walls.A 3-story and a 6-story CLT buildings are designed according to the force-based design method recommended in the standards and a simplified FEM model of the whole structures developed finally for each of the building.A suite of 41 biaxial earthquake ground motions are selected and scaled to three ensembles of ground motions representing rare medium and frequent earthquake ground motions respectively according to the design spectrum of each ensemble.Then incremental dynamic analysis(IDA) is applied to analyze the CLT buildings aforementioned.According to the IDA curves of the inter-story drifts and the definition in reliability standard,the limit inter-story drifts for rare,medium and frequent earthquake ground motions are defined respectively.
